It was the first public university in Texas, and one of just 2 flagship colleges in Texas. The university has actually been a participant of the Organization of American Universities considering that 2001. Today, the campus in College Station covers 5,200 acres. With its abundant background in farming education, trainees are called "Aggies", and the institution is generally called "Aggieland".

Over a two-year period (2014-15), Kyle Area underwent among the largest and most comprehensive redevelopment task in the history of college athletics. The redeveloped Kyle Area includes a broadened seating capacity of 102,733, making it among the five largest stadiums in college football. The $485 million redevelopment was finished in two phases and made its launching for the 2015 period.

Shrub's presidency, the Union Pacific locomotive births the number 4141, in honor of the 41st head of state. On December 6, 2018, Union Pacific was honored to join Head of state Bush's funeral train, led by No. 4141, from Spring to College Station, Texas. No. 4141 now is on display in front of the George Bush Presidential Library and Museum on the Texas A&M school.

Easterwood Flight terminal is had and operated by Texas A&M College (TAMU) and is the sole air facility within the Bryan-College Terminal municipal location and the academy bryan college station tx Research Valley. Easterwood is a successful non-hub local airport providing set up industrial airline solution and superior general aviation facilities.
